XES Dividend FAQ
The SPDR® S&P Oil & Gas Equipment & Services ETF (XES) aims to replicate the S&P Oil & Gas Equipment & Services Select Industry Index by using a sampling approach, investing at least 80% of its assets in the index constituents. The index captures the equipment and services segment within the broader S&P Total Market Index, providing exposure to U.S. companies that supply drilling rigs, well-completion tools, and related services to the upstream oil and gas industry.

XES`s Overall Dividend Rating is 61.53%. Ratings surpassing 65% are regarded as acceptable, exceeding 75% are favorable and surpassing 85% are strong.Key Metric Definitions
- Dividend Yield
- Annual dividend per share divided by current share price.
- Payout Ratio
- Percentage of earnings paid as dividends. Below 60% = safe, above 100% = unsustainable.
- Payout FCF
- Percentage of Free Cash Flow paid as dividends. More reliable than Payout Ratio since it measures actual cash.
- Growth Rate (CAGR)
- Compound annual growth rate of dividends over the last 5 years.
- Consistency
- Reliability of dividend payments over lifetime. Penalizes cuts and pauses.
- Yield on Cost
- Your effective yield if you bought 5 years ago. Shows dividend growth impact over time.
- Streak
- Consecutive years of dividend payments. 25+ years = Dividend Aristocrat.
- Dividend Rating
- Proprietary score (0-100) combining yield, growth, safety and consistency.
